China Zhongqing T800 Humanoid Robot Launched: 25 Thousand Dollars Start, Solid-State Power Battery

Humanoid robots have long represented the highest level of mechanical innovation, blending engineering precision with biological inspiration. In December 2025, Zhongqing’s newly launched T800 humanoid robot, starting at 25 Thousand Dollars, enters this competitive landscape with a bold statement: industrial-grade humanoid robots can be both powerful and practical.

Unlike concept-stage machines or polished lab demos, the T800 is engineered for real deployment—from industrial collaboration to service operations—thanks to its ergonomic proportions, high-strength materials, and an advanced full-stack mechatronic system.

A Human-Centric Form Factor Designed for Real-World Work

The Zhongqing T800 adopts the proportions of an average adult: 1.73 meters tall and 75 kilograms in optimized weight. This deliberate choice goes beyond aesthetics. By aligning with human body mechanics, the T800 achieves:

  • Better compatibility with existing industrial environments
  • More natural interaction with humans
  • Higher adaptability in service scenarios
  • Greater capability in operating common tools and equipment

Its streamlined chassis is built using aerospace-grade magnesium-aluminum alloy, produced through an integrated high-pressure casting process. This gives the robot not only lightweight rigidity but also excellent impact resistance and long-term durability, particularly important for continuous industrial workloads.

Dynamic Visual Feedback and Enhanced Human–Machine Interaction

A distinctive design feature is the dynamic interaction lightband integrated into the torso. Through color changes and light-pulse frequencies, users can instantly understand the robot’s working state, warnings, or instructions.

This type of intuitive communication significantly smooths collaboration between human operators and the robot, reducing the learning curve in industrial and service environments.

Bionic Foot Structure for Complex Ground Conditions

Mobility is one of the hardest challenges for a humanoid robot. Zhongqing addresses this with a bionic anti-noise foot structure modeled after human foot mechanics.

The T800’s feet use:

  • High-elastic shock-absorbing materials
  • Anti-slip composite coatings
  • Abrasion-resistant soles

This allows the robot to maintain stability across diverse environments—from factory floors to outdoor surfaces—while reducing vibration and operational noise.

High-Output Joint System: 450 N·m Peak Torque and 14,000 W Burst Power

At the core of the T800’s movement capabilities lies Zhongqing’s full-stack integrated high-burst joint module. The mechanical output numbers are remarkable for a humanoid robot in this price range:

  • 450 N·m peak joint torque
  • 14,000 W peak instantaneous power
  • High-degree-of-freedom joints in the neck, waist, and hands

These specifications enable the robot to perform highly human-like dynamic movements, including rapid rotations and complex balancing tasks. In fact, Zhongqing’s demo videos showing the T800 performing aerial spinning kicks and even breaking a door with a single strike have drawn widespread attention.

While visually impressive, these motions also illustrate the robot’s ability to handle real-world tasks requiring explosive force, precision, and stability.

Full-Stack Perception System: 360° Lidar and Millisecond-Level Mapping

The T800 combines Zhongqing’s proprietary micro joint electromechanical technology with an integrated perception architecture:

  • 360° all-directional lidar sensing
  • Millisecond-level environmental modeling
  • AI-driven path planning

This allows the robot to recognize obstacles, optimize movement routes, and adjust its posture in real time. The resulting locomotion is not only smooth but adaptable to dynamic human environments—a crucial requirement for both industrial and service deployments.

Bionic Dexterous Hand: From Heavy Lifting to Fine Manipulation

One of the most sophisticated subsystems on the T800 is its self-developed multi-dimensional dexterous hand.
The hand combines:

  • Bionic joint structure
  • Integrated tactile sensors
  • High-accuracy force-control system

This gives the robot the unique ability to switch between:

  • Heavy-load tasks (e.g., lifting and transferring materials)
  • Precision operations (e.g., sorting small components, handing delicate objects)

Such versatility is essential for industries looking to automate complex workflows that require both strength and finesse.

High-Performance Solid-State Battery with 4–5 Hours of Active Runtime

To support intensive workloads, the T800 features the industry’s first solid-state power battery built specifically for humanoid robots. This unit provides:

  • 4–5 hours of stable continuous operation
  • High safety performance
  • Strong resistance to temperature shifts

Additionally, the robot integrates full-joint active cooling across the legs. Temperature regulation is continuously monitored, ensuring that peak performance remains stable during prolonged tasks.

The combination of solid-state battery architecture and intelligent cooling forms a dual safety-and-performance system rarely seen in commercial humanoid robots.

Preparing for Mass Deployment: Zhongqing’s Digital Manufacturing Base

Zhongqing has confirmed that its full-chain digital intelligent manufacturing base is entering the final stages before operational launch. This facility is expected to support mass production of the T800, ensuring consistent quality and allowing the product to scale into commercial and industrial markets.

According to the company, the T800 has already completed closed-loop technical verification in multiple application domains and is ready for large-scale deployment—something few humanoid robots can claim today.

Product Line and Pricing

The T800 is available in a four-tier product matrix:

  • Basic Edition
  • Ecosystem Edition (Open-Source Version)
  • Sharpened Edition (Pro)
  • Flagship Edition (Max)

Prices start at 25 Thousand Dollars, making it one of the most competitively priced full-featured humanoid robots currently entering industrial applications.
